Which of the following are general characteristics of hierarchical cultures?
1. Those in power do not receive special opportunities.
2. There are few status differences between leaders and others.
3. People in power have more privileges than others.
4. People are expected to follow leaders without questioning them

All Answers 1

Answered by GPT-5 mini AI
Correct choices: 3 and 4.

Explanation: Hierarchical (high power-distance) cultures feature clear status differences—people in power have more privileges and are expected to be followed without much questioning. Statements 1 and 2 describe low power-distance (egalitarian) cultures, so they are not characteristics of hierarchical cultures.
